Hey, the first shave in the intimate area is of course very exciting and complicated. With a little experience, you’ll get it with time. It’s very important now that you take a lot of time for intimacy and relax. Then you will automatically get a better result.
The best way to shower before your shaving is to wash yourself well in the intimate area, which will prevent pimples. Next, you take shaving gel or shaving foam and foam your intimate area very well. I personally prefer to take razor gel, but if you take razor gel or razor foam now is your decision.
For your intimacy, you now take your wet shaver and shave very carefully with the wet shaver into the hair growth direction, which also avoids pimples. It is very important that you use as fresh as possible a blade for intimacy and exchange it when you have shaved with it several times. I would also advise you to use a good wet shaver for shaving intimacy and not to use a disposable shaver.
After about 2-3 trains with the wet shaver, you should rinse your razor blades once so that they do not clog. For example, if you’re shaking on your testicle bag, you should always tighten your skin, it’s easier. In any case, you should take care of the shave in the intimate area and not let yourself be distracted. It is not very pleasant to hurt intimacy.
If you have shaved at all desired locations in the intimate area, then you wash away the remaining shaving foam and clean your intimate area again with warm water. After that you dry gently in the intimate area.
Care after shaving in intimate areas is also very important to avoid pimples and skin irritations I always use a normal body cream from Nivea after my shaving in intimate areas. So far, I have rarely had isolated pimples in the intimate area.
If you’re following all the tips here now, you can actually run very few. It’s important that you leave your time intimacy. A quick result is not necessarily the best.

In the hair growth direction it is when you shave in the direction in which your pubic hair naturally grows. Against the hair growth direction it is when you shave against the direction in which your pubic hair naturally grows. The hair growth direction is slightly different for each person.
I would definitely recommend you to radiate into the hair growth direction, which does not irritate the skin so much and there are fewer pimples.
